Valerio Bernabò

Italian rugby player and international representative

Valerio Bernabò - Italian rugby player and international representative
Born

March 3rd, 1984
41 years ago

Category

Athletes & Sports Figures

Country

Italy

Links & References

Played as a flanker and number eight primarily for the Italian national rugby union team. Competed in multiple Six Nations Championships and represented Italy in the 2011 Rugby World Cup. Played for club teams including Benetton Treviso and Rugby Calvisano, contributing to their domestic successes.

Competed in 2011 Rugby World Cup

Participated in Six Nations Championships

Zhelyu Zhelev

Bulgarian politician and philosopher
Born
March 3rd, 1935 90 years ago
Died
January 30th, 2015 10 years ago — 79 years old

Served as the second President of Bulgaria from 1990 to 1997, contributing to the transition from communism to democracy. Before his presidency, engaged in philosophical work and opposition activities against the communist regime. Founded the Union of Democratic Forces and played a significant role in the political changes during the late 1980s and early 1990s. His tenure involved significant reforms in the political landscape of Bulgaria, promoting a multi-party system and economic stability.

Michael Walzer

Philosopher specializing in just war theory
Born
March 3rd, 1935 90 years ago

This philosopher is recognized for contributions to political philosophy and moral theory. Teaching at institutions such as Princeton University and the Institute for Advanced Study, this individual has explored topics including justice, equality, and the moral implications of war. The publication of 'Just and Unjust Wars' provided a framework for discussions surrounding the ethics of warfare, establishing a lasting reputation in the field. Other influential works include 'Spheres of Justice' and 'The Company of Critics'.
